summaryrefslogtreecommitdiffstats
path: root/spec/spec/interface-function-definition.yml
diff options
context:
space:
mode:
Diffstat (limited to 'spec/spec/interface-function-definition.yml')
-rw-r--r--spec/spec/interface-function-definition.yml7
1 files changed, 7 insertions, 0 deletions
diff --git a/spec/spec/interface-function-definition.yml b/spec/spec/interface-function-definition.yml
index c4297969..40e3db63 100644
--- a/spec/spec/interface-function-definition.yml
+++ b/spec/spec/interface-function-definition.yml
@@ -10,6 +10,13 @@ spec-example: null
spec-info:
dict:
attributes:
+ attributes:
+ description: |
+ If the value is present, then it shall be the function attributes.
+ On the attributes a context-sensitive substitution of item variables
+ is performed. A function attribute is for example the indication
+ that the function does not return to the caller.
+ spec-type: optional-str
body:
description: |
If the value is present, then it shall be the definition of a static